The final qualification is the addition of the following partial qualification:Class activities: 30%Memory of the final project 50%Deffense of the final project 20%Final project: Doing a photogrametric project related with the arquitectonic and/or archeologic surveying (associated concepts to the goals of learning of the subject). It will be delievered a memory of all the projects and drawings of detail. It will be carried out an oral exposition of the developed topic.

Bibliography
Basic:
Complementary:
Atkinson, K.B. Close range photogrammetry and machine vision. Caithness, UK: Whittles, 2001. ISBN 978-1870325-73-8.
Buill, Felipe; Núñez Andrés, M. Amparo; Rodríguez Jordana, Joan. Fotogrametría arquitectónica. Barcelona: Edicions UPC, 2007. ISBN 978-84-8301-920-7.
Ioannides, Marinos. Progress in cultural heritage preservation : 4th international conference, EuroMed 2012, Limassol, Cyprus, October 29-November 3, 2012 : proceedings [on line]. Heidelberg [etc.]: Springer, cop. 2012 [Consultation: 21/07/2015]. Available on: <http://link.springer.com/book/10.1007/978-3-642-34234-9/page/1>. ISBN 978-3-642-34234-9.
Hartley, Richard; Zisserman, Andrew. Multiple view geometry in computer vision. 2nd ed. Cambridge [etc.]: Cambridge University Press, 2003. ISBN 9780521540513.
McGlone, J. Ch.. Manual of photogrammetry. 5th ed. Virginia: American Society of Photogrammetry, 2004. ISBN 978-1570830716.
